Computing device with environment aware features

1. An electronic device, comprising:
- a processor;
an output device connected to the processor for issuing a user stimulus to a user of the electronic device;
at least one input device connected to the processor and responsive to user interaction; and
a device lock module associated with the processor, the device lock module being configured for initiating a lockout countdown timer having an interval set to an initial value;
monitoring for user interaction within the interval;
implementing the restrictions on user access when user interaction is not detected within the interval;
monitoring for issuance of the user stimulus within the interval; and
setting a time remaining in the interval to a second value less than the initial value when the user stimulus is issued during the interval;
wherein the device lock module is configured such that, when the user stimulus is issued during the interval, the time remaining in the interval is set to the second value only when the time remaining exceeds the second value when the user stimulus is issued.

Abstract
An electronic device is provided that includes a processor, an output device connected to the processor for issuing a stimulus to a user of the electronic device, and at least one input device connected to the processor and responsive to user interaction. The electronic device also includes a device lock module associated with the processor for implementing restrictions on user access to the electronic device if user interaction is not detected within a predetermined lockout-time interval, the device lock module being configured for resetting the lockout-time interval into a shorter value if a user stimulus is issued by the output device.
